Sorry to say but the advice from your friend is not sound and is about 30 years old. A damsel/fish produces ammonia to help get the cycle going - but this can be easily done via a piece of shrimp you might buy at any local supermarket. It's definitely more humane at least since a fish living...
brine shrimp (the just-hatched babies excluded) is the nutrional equivalent to popcorn for humans.
It's fun to eat and the fish love it - but it's nutritionally inadequate. Feed it as a treat - not as a staple. Good luck!
